Output 8512099e0ae7bfc6563c09e69ddd5d72193037a3db4e0595dc33ac0773149fea:0

value
3235785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0ed1069593d04a234915f3465f283ce01d7358b OP_EQUAL
address
3LjiTwuRVX3pxMpmvsuW7vLgiqgLL88g6p
transaction
8512099e0ae7bfc6563c09e69ddd5d72193037a3db4e0595dc33ac0773149fea